Why is water pollution of great concern in Southwest Asia?
A.
because clean drinking water is scarce in the region
B.
because the economy is dependent upon exporting water
C.
because it prevents ships from traveling along major waterways
D.
because it reduces the amount of electricity generated by hydropower
All Answers 1
Answered by
GPT-5 mini
AI
A. because clean drinking water is scarce in the region
Explanation: Southwest Asia (Middle East) is arid with limited freshwater resources; pollution of those scarce supplies has serious impacts on drinking water availability, public health, and agriculture.
